Travel Perks: Explore Mason City, IA
Mason City is a charming North Iowa hub with cultural and outdoor perks. Explore Frank Lloyd Wright's Park Inn Hotel and Stockman House, wander Music Man Square to celebrate the town's Musical heritage, or take easy day trips to nearby Clear Lake for boating, beaches, and the famous Surf Ballroom. Enjoy local farmers markets, cozy restaurants, and parks for weekend walks and fresh-air time.
